This is Middle Eastern music after it's moved to Manhattan and spent a lot of nights sipping whisky in dim jazz joints -- yes, that cool. Simon Shaheen bucked convention with 2001's Blue Flame, setting his virtuosic oud and violin playing within a combo that suggests jazz more than traditional Middle Eastern music. The gamble paid off: Shaheen neither violates nor cheapens his traditions with the fusion, instead forging the kind of musical exploration that the best jazz has always trafficked in. The album received 11 Grammy nominations; it's easy to hear why.
